Abstract

This paper presents near-field and far-field LES results from a hybrid RANS/LES simulation of two high-speed jets at M=0.9 (T j/T=0.86: Tanna's Set Point 7 (SP7) and T j/T=2.7: Tanna's Set Point 46 (SP46)).17 The near-field pressure is analyzed in terms of hydrodynamic wave-packets (Reba et al.10) to quantify the large scale turbulence noise source. Results indicate that the simulation reasonably captures the spatio-temporal evolution of the large-scale turbulence. However, the LES-predicted turbulence structures appear to be significantly more energetic, with a consistent over-prediction of 10 dB in the near-field pressure. The acoustic far field is computed using a Ffowcs-Williams/Hawkings surface. Acoustic results show good qualitative agreement with the experimental data The predicted far field OASPL directivity pattern compares well with the experiments, despite an over-prediction of 3 dB and 10 dB for SP7 and SP46, respectively.
